Using Bluetooth
Another convenient way to connect your iPhone to the Echo Show is via Bluetooth. Follow these steps:
Step 1: Enter Bluetooth Pairing Mode
On your Echo Show, say, “Alexa, pair Bluetooth.” This will make your Echo Show discoverable.
Step 2: Access Bluetooth Settings on Your iPhone
On your iPhone, navigate to “Settings,” then “Bluetooth.” Ensure that Bluetooth is turned on.
Step 3: Select the Echo Show
In the list of available devices, find your Echo Show and tap on it to connect.
Step 4: Confirmation
You will hear a confirmation from your Echo Show indicating that the pairing was successful. You can now stream audio from your iPhone to your Echo Show!
Using Apple Music Integration
If you’re an Apple Music subscriber, connecting your account to the Echo Show allows you to control music playback directly through your device. Here’s how:
Step 1: Open the Alexa App
Launch the Alexa app and tap on “More” in the bottom right corner.
Step 2: Choose Settings
Select “Settings,” then tap on “Music & Podcasts.”
Step 3: Link Your Apple Music Account
Choose “Link New Service” and select Apple Music. Follow the prompts to log into your Apple Music account and allow Alexa access.
Step 4: Voice Control
Now you can use voice commands such as “Alexa, play my playlist on Apple Music,” allowing you to enjoy your favorite tunes effortlessly.
Troubleshooting Connection Issues
Despite following the steps above, you may encounter issues connecting your iPhone to the Echo Show. Here are some common troubleshooting tips:
1. Check Bluetooth Settings
If your iPhone isn’t connecting via Bluetooth, ensure that Bluetooth is enabled on both devices. If they still won’t connect, try restarting both your iPhone and Echo Show.
2. Wi-Fi Connection Issues
If there are issues with connecting via the app, verify that both devices are connected to the same Wi-Fi network. Check your router settings if necessary.
3. Reset Your Devices
If you continue to have problems, consider performing a reset on your Echo Show. This can often resolve persistent connectivity issues. To reset, press and hold the mute and volume down buttons until the device restarts.

How do I unlink my iPhone from the Echo Show?
To unlink your iPhone from your Echo Show, you can do so easily through the Alexa app. Open the app and go to the ‘Devices’ tab, then select your Echo Show. In the settings section, scroll down to find the option to unlink or disconnect your iPhone. Confirm your choice when prompted. This will remove any linked features, but you can always link it again later if needed.
Alternatively, you can also unlink your iPhone through the Bluetooth settings on your device. By going to your phone’s Bluetooth settings and forgetting the Echo Show, you will essentially remove the connection. Remember that unlinking means you’ll need to set up the connection again if you wish to use the features in the future.
